Postby MagicManICT » Wed Jul 06, 2011 2:39 pm

oddball wrote:Tell me how to do that, i dont know anyone in village so what can i do? :)


Join someone's village. Destroy your hearth fire. Travel to Village idol.

You can also PM Loftar or Jorb and try requesting some help. They might be able to move you out of the nuked area.

edit: You could also just destroy your own HF and log out. When you log back in, you will have the option to log in to the wilderness where log in to your hearth fire was.
